The 2004 Chevrolet Silverado uses a 9145 fog light bulb size and can also work with an LED version instead of the traditional bulbs. To replace the fog lights, start by removing the headlight housing. Undo the fastening pin located at the top of the headlight housing to release it. Once that's done, twist and remove the headlight bulb from its socket. Keep them in a safe place. Beneath the headlight housing, you'll find the socket for the fog light bulb. Twist and remove the socket, then pull out the old fog light bulb from the socket. Insert the new bulb by simply snapping it in place. Finally, reverse the steps to reassemble everything back together.
